How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Roosevelt Phalen Center?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Roosevelt Phalen Center Studio Apartments | $960 | $736 | $1,425 |
Roosevelt Phalen Center 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,359 | $775 | $2,166 |
Roosevelt Phalen Center 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,658 | $965 | $2,677 |
Roosevelt Phalen Center 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,571 | $1,550 | $2,900 |
Roosevelt Phalen Center 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,950 | $1,950 | $1,950 |
